Eve Sets Release Date For First Album in 11 Years

A new album is on its way courtesy of the masterful Eve.

The artist put out word herself via Twitter in a tweet that simply said “Check this out tweeps” with a link to an article announcing the news on Billboard.com. The album will be entitled “Lip Lock” and is Eve’s first in 11 years.

Eve dropped the single, “She Bad Bad,” on Oct. 9 and released the video for it Jan. 8. It’s already gotten over 1.2 million views, so it’s safe to say we the fans, missed her.

"One of the biggest things that I wanted to do on this album was make people realize why they fell in love with me in the first place and then take them on a journey to where I am now musically. My ear is different but I think people will recognize me. I think you'll hear that I'm in a happy place. I miss my music. My hunger is different than the first time around," Eve said.

She plans on introducing some new sounds on her new album. “It’s not the sound that people are used to.”

“Lip Lock” will be released on Eve’s recently formed independent label, From The Ribs Music (FTR Music) and distributed through Sony/Red on May 17.
